How Inexpensive Must Energy Storage Be for Utilities to Switch to 100
High-temperature sodium-sulfur batteries cost $500/kWh, but with more development, their costs could fall by up to 75 percent by 2030, according to the International Renewable Energy Agency.
Home Battery Costs Revealed: What You''ll Actually Pay in 2024
The cost of home battery storage has plummeted from over $1,000 per kilowatt-hour (kWh) a decade ago to around $200-400/kWh today, making residential energy storage increasingly accessible to
